Systems Engineering and Assessment Limited is looking for an ECAD Electrical & Electronic Team Leader to lead the drafting team in the UK. This full-time role involves overseeing the creation of schematic, PCB, and wiring design outputs, managing standards and workflows, and ensuring high-quality documentation. The position offers a competitive salary of £65,000 and focuses on effective collaboration and continuous improvement within the team.
